Output 960d2d383c685819f53dda11db650ae98e2b7cb4c7ed7acc1db8e30a71c95072:1

value
74367821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05191413c982d236351b059a19ed8ea1241baeba OP_EQUAL
address
329yLywaEkQtgR1atNzZkoqrASP66hmqQA
transaction
960d2d383c685819f53dda11db650ae98e2b7cb4c7ed7acc1db8e30a71c95072
confirmations
472919
spent
true